Maruti Suzuki Introduced Celerio Limited Edition at ₹4.99 Lakh

Maruti Suzuki has launched a special Limited Edition of its popular hatchback, the Celerio, priced at ₹4.99 lakh (ex-showroom, Delhi). This new variant comes with additional accessories worth ₹11,000, offered at no extra cost until December 20, 2024, aiming to attract year-end car buyers seeking enhanced features without a hefty price tag.

Exclusive Accessories Enhance Appeal

The Celerio Limited Edition boasts several aesthetic upgrades that set it apart from the standard model. Exterior enhancements include a sleek body kit, chrome-accented side moldings, and a sporty black roof spoiler, giving the car a more dynamic and stylish appearance.

Inside, the vehicle features dual-tone door sill guards and premium floor mats, elevating the cabin's comfort and visual appeal.

Unchanged Performance and Efficiency

Under the hood, the Limited Edition Celerio retains the reliable 1.0-litre K-Series petrol engine, delivering 66 bhp and 89 Nm of peak torque. Buyers have an option to choose between an automated manual transmission (AMT) and a 5-speed manual transmission.

Additionally, a CNG variant is available, producing 56 bhp and 82.1 Nm of torque, paired exclusively with a 5-speed manual gearbox. The petrol variant offers impressive fuel efficiency, with mileage figures up to 26.68 kmpl for the AMT version, while the CNG model delivers up to 34.43 km/kg, making it an economical choice for daily commuting.

Pricing and Availability

The Celerio Limited Edition is attractively priced at ₹4.99 lakh, making it accessible to a wide range of customers. The inclusion of ₹11,000 worth of accessories at no additional cost enhances its value proposition.
